Sobre este artículo

New York: Exeter Books, 1988. good. 255, illus. (some color, some diagrams), index, boards somewhat worn and small chips. Junkers, Fokker, Sopwith, Vickers, Dornier, Douglas C3, and more are described in this profusely illustrated book. Complete with technical specifications, color and black-and-white photos, and cutaway drawings, the book presents an indepth developmental history of 31 aircraft. Includes technical specifications.
